Formulating a Functional and Inspiring Classroom: A Furniture Guide

A well-organized classroom is crucial for student progress. Furniture plays a vital role in creating an effective learning environment. Selecting the appropriate pieces can improve both functionality and inspiration.

When choosing classroom furniture, consider the grade level of your students. Infants learners often benefit from smaller, more inviting seating options, while teenager students may require larger desks and chairs that support focused study.

Flexible furniture is a great option for classrooms, as it allows you to rapidly reorganize the space to suit different learning activities. For example, flexible desks and chairs can be grouped into group work areas or spread out for independent study.

Avoid forgetting storage solutions! Shelves are important for keeping the classroom organized. Look for functional pieces that can hold both supplies and student work.

In Conclusion, a well-designed classroom should be both efficient and stimulating. By choosing the right furniture, you can create a learning environment that encourages student success.
